1. In her class in Accounting, Miss Kay told the students that they need a grade in the top 10% of the class to get an A in a particular test. In the standardization of the test, the mean was 70 and the standard deviation was 12. Assuming that the grades would be nomally distributed, what must be the minimum grade needed to oblain an A? a) Does the normal curve apply in the problem? b) Under the curve, where is the top 10% located? c) In the Final run, what do we need to find ----a z or a raw Scoret
